Cadmium telluride (CdTe) thin-film PV modules are the primary thin film product on the global market, with more than 30 GW peak (GWp) generating capacity representing many millions of modules installed worldwide, primarily in utility-scale power plants in the US.
The majority of contemporary Si modules utilize polymer/plastic backsheets which can also release toxic and carcinogenic substances under conditions of incomplete combustion. It is important to consider such secondary risks of CdTe photovoltaics not in isolation but in the context of other points of comparison.
Another strand of concern regarding CdTe solar modules are the chance of carcinogenic emissions if modules are involved in fires .
CdTe photovoltaics currently consumes a significant fraction of global Te production, but Te is also used in thermoelectric devices (e.g. PbTe), metallurgy, vulcanizing rubber, and other uses .
In this sense, the use of Cd and Te as CdTe photovoltaics represents a very good use for these derivatives of primary metal production that would otherwise be released to the environment or require managed sequestration.
